John Adams
• John Adams • Term: 2nd President of the United
States (1797-1801)• Born: October 30, 1735, Braintree
Massachusetts• Nickname: "Atlas of
Independence"• Education: Harvard College
(graduated 1755)• Religion: Unitarian• Career: Lawyer• Marriage: October 25, 1764, to
Abigail Smith (1744-1818)• Children: Abigail Amelia (1765-
1813), John Quincy (1767-1848), Susanna (1768-1770), Charles (1770-1832), Thomas Boylston (1772-1832)
• Political Party: Federalist• Died: July 4, 1826, in Quincy,
Massachusetts
Events of Adams’ Presidency
• XYZ Affair- France was seizing American ships in the Caribbean. Adams sent three diplomats to France hoping to avoid war. Three agents for the French government demanded a personal bribe of $250,000 and a loan of $10 million for France. TalleyRand
• Building of the American Navy
• Federalist Party Splits- Federalists wanted war with France. Angered by Adams’ refusal to go to war with France the party split.
• Alien Act- Allowed the President to expel any alien, or foreigner, thought to be dangerous to the country.
• Sedition Act- Citizens could be fined or jailed if they criticized the government or its officials.
